For decades, Hollywood had a cruel expiration date for women. Once an actress hit 40, the offers dried up. The "love interest" roles went to women in their 20s, and the scripts that did land on a mature woman’s desk were often relegated to "wise grandmother," "grieving mother," or "comic relief neighbor." From the ferocious boardrooms of Succession to the haunting silence of The White Lotus , mature women in cinema and television are no longer the side characters. They are the plot. Let’s be honest: the industry used to believe that audiences only wanted to watch youth. The logic was archaic: "Sex sells, and sex equals young."

The entertainment industry is waking up to the fact that a life lived is an actor’s greatest asset. Those lines around the eyes? They aren't flaws. They are the map of a character we actually want to watch.
